Revenue, Agent, and Transaction Growth:
- Fathom Holdings Inc.FTHM-- reported revenue of $121.4 million for Q2 2025, up 36.1% year-over-year.
- The company also experienced a 25% increase in transactions and a 23% rise in agent count.
- This growth was driven by the acquisition of My Home Group, the success of the Elevate program, and competitive commission structures.
Elevate Program Success:
- Fathom's Elevate Agent Concierge program has been successful, with 8 transactions per agent on average and over 1,700 leads generated in July.
- Elevate transactions generate 4x the gross profit and 5x the adjusted EBITDA of standard broker transactions.
- The program's success is due to its productivity enhancement, agent satisfaction, and high-margin recurring revenue for Fathom.
Ancillary Services Expansion:
- Verus Title, an ancillary service, saw a 90% increase in revenue to $1.5 million in Q2 2025.
- The growth in this segment was driven by strong organic growth from increased order volumes, enhanced agent relationships, and process efficiency improvements.
Profitability and EBITDA:
- Fathom returned to adjusted EBITDA profitability in Q2 2025 with a non-GAAP adjusted EBITDA of $29,000.
- The company achieved this by improving operating leverage and a higher proportion of revenue converting to earnings.
- Cost management initiatives and strategic investments in technology and marketing also contributed to this milestone.
Real Estate Market Outlook:
- Fathom anticipates a modest recovery in transaction volume due to increased inventory, easing affordability pressures, and potential lower mortgage rates.
- The company is positioned to outpace the broader market, supported by its agent-centric model and strategic initiatives.
- This outlook is driven by the company's competitive pricing, strong agent satisfaction, and integrated platform services.
